Sleep and Circadian Therapeutic Intervention Synthesis

Introduction

Sleep and circadian disruption represent one of the most promising yet underexploited therapeutic intervention points in neurodegenerative disease. The bidirectional relationship between neurodegeneration and circadian dysfunction creates a self-reinforcing pathological cycle: neurodegenerative pathology damages sleep-regulating circuits, while impaired sleep accelerates pathological protein accumulation through failure of glymphatic clearance and other mechanisms. This synthesis evaluates therapeutic approaches targeting the sleep-circadian axis, including melatonin signaling, orexin modulation, light therapy, and chronotherapeutic strategies, with investment prioritization based on mechanism strength, clinical evidence, and pipeline maturity.

Therapeutic Target Classes

1. Melatonin Signaling Agonists

Melatonin acts through MT1 and MT2 receptors to regulate circadian rhythm, provide antioxidant effects, and modulate neuroinflammation. The pathway has gained significant attention following recent discoveries of MT1-mediated alpha-synuclein clearance through LC3-associated phagocytosis in microglia[@yaoxy2024] and Sirt1/Nrf2 pathway activation preventing ferroptosis in PD models[@lvv2024].
